顶部
收藏

全国计算机等级考试二级教程——openGauss数据库程序设计


作者:
教育部考试中心
定价:
59.00元
ISBN:
978-7-04-058018-1
版面字数:
470.000千字
开本:
16开
全书页数:
暂无
装帧形式:
平装
重点项目:
暂无
出版时间:
2022-02-28
读者对象:
考试用书
一级分类:
计算机考试
二级分类:
全国计算机等级考试(NCRE)
三级分类:
计算机等考一级

本教材为全国计算机等级考试二级openGauss数据库程序设计而编写,全书分为9章,包括数据库基础、openGauss概述、openGauss应用基础、openGauss数据库的管理、数据定义与数据操作、数据查询、openGauss数据库编程、openGauss数据库安全管理以及openGauss数据库事务管理与备份恢复等内容。

本书可作为参加二级openGauss数据库程序设计考试的参考教材,还可作为各类高等院校相关专业与数据库相关的课程教材使用,也可供相关技术人员参考。

  • 前辅文
  • 第1章 数据库基础
    • 1.1 数据管理及其发展过程
      • 1.1.1 数据管理
      • 1.1.2 人工管理阶段
      • 1.1.3 文件系统阶段
      • 1.1.4 数据库系统阶段及其发展过程
      • 1.1.5 数据管理和数据库技术的持续发展
    • 1.2 数据库系统的特点
    • 1.3 数据模型初步
      • 1.3.1 概念数据模型
      • 1.3.2 传统的三大数据模型
    • 1.4 数据库系统及其结构
      • 1.4.1 数据库管理系统的基本功能
      • 1.4.2 数据库的三层模式结构
      • 1.4.3 数据库管理系统的基本框架
      • 1.4.4 数据库系统的组成
      • 1.4.5 数据库管理和数据库管理员
    • 1.5 关系数据库与关系数据模型
      • 1.5.1 关系数据模型的三个要素
      • 1.5.2 关系模型的数据结构和基本术语
      • 1.5.3 关系的规范化
      • 1.5.4 关系模型的完整性约束
      • 1.5.5 关系数据库的三层模式结构
      • 1.5.6 关系代数
    • 1.6 数据库设计
      • 1.6.1 数据库设计的概念与方法
      • 1.6.2 数据库设计的步骤
      • 1.6.3 概念数据模型设计
      • 1.6.4 逻辑数据模型设计
      • 1.6.5 物理数据模型设计
    • 本章小结
    • 习题与练习
  • 第2章 openGauss概述
    • 2.1 openGauss系统架构
    • 2.2 openGauss特性和使用场景
    • 2.3 openGauss数据库服务器的安装与配置
      • 2.3.1 安装流程
      • 2.3.2 准备安装环境
      • 2.3.3 获取安装包
      • 2.3.4 创建XML配置文件
      • 2.3.5 初始化安装环境
      • 2.3.6 执行安装
      • 2.3.7 安装生成的目录
      • 2.3.8 数据库状态检查及连接
    • 2.4 openGauss数据库服务器的启动与关闭
      • 2.4.1 命令格式
      • 2.4.2 启动数据库
      • 2.4.3 关闭数据库
      • 2.4.4 具体使用实例
    • 2.5 openGauss数据库客户端工具gsql
      • 2.5.1 gsql的基本操作
      • 2.5.2 gsql的高级特性
    • 2.6 openGauss数据库服务端工具
      • 2.6.1 gs_check
      • 2.6.2 gs_checkperf
      • 2.6.3 gs_collector
      • 2.6.4 gs_dump
      • 2.6.5 gs_guc
      • 2.6.6 gs_restore
    • 本章小结
    • 习题与练习
  • 第3章 openGauss应用基础
    • 3.1 SQL及openGauss SQL概述
    • 3.2 数据类型
      • 3.2.1 常规数据类型
      • 3.2.2 特殊数据类型
    • 3.3 常量与宏
    • 3.4 操作符和内置函数
      • 3.4.1 操作符
      • 3.4.2 openGauss常用函数
    • 3.5 条件表达式和子查询表达式
      • 3.5.1 条件表达式
      • 3.5.2 子查询表达式
    • 本章小结
    • 习题与练习
  • 第4章 openGauss数据库的管理
    • 4.1 连接数据库
      • 4.1.1 确认连接信息
      • 4.1.2 使用gsql连接数据库
    • 4.2 创建和管理表空间
      • 4.2.1 系统表空间
      • 4.2.2 创建表空间
      • 4.2.3 查看表空间
      • 4.2.4 修改和删除表空间
    • 4.3 创建和管理数据库
      • 4.3.1 创建数据库
      • 4.3.2 查看数据库
      • 4.3.3 修改和删除数据库
    • 本章小结
    • 习题与练习
  • 第5章 数据定义与数据操作
    • 5.1 模式
      • 5.1.1 什么是模式
      • 5.1.2 模式的管理
    • 5.2 SQL的表定义和完整性定义功能
      • 5.2.1 CREATE TABLE命令
      • 5.2.2 定义表及其完整性约束实例
      • 5.2.3 修改表结构
      • 5.2.4 删除表
    • 5.3 索引
      • 5.3.1 索引及其使用原则
      • 5.3.2 创建索引
      • 5.3.3 修改和重建索引
      • 5.3.4 删除索引
    • 5.4 SQL数据操作与完整性约束的作用
      • 5.4.1 插入操作及其完整性约束的作用
      • 5.4.2 删除操作及其完整性约束的作用
      • 5.4.3 更新操作及其完整性约束的作用
    • 5.5 序数类型的简单应用
    • 本章小结
    • 习题与练习
  • 第6章 数据查询
    • 6.1 SELECT语句的命令格式
    • 6.2 简单查询
      • 6.2.1 简单无条件查询
      • 6.2.2 简单有条件查询
      • 6.2.3 存储查询结果
      • 6.2.4 对查询结果排序
      • 6.2.5 限制查询结果的数量
    • 6.3 连接查询
      • 6.3.1 使用JOIN关键字的连接查询的语法格式
      • 6.3.2 内连接
      • 6.3.3 外连接
      • 6.3.4 交叉连接
    • 6.4 分组及汇总查询
      • 6.4.1 使用聚合函数查询
      • 6.4.2 分组汇总查询
    • 6.5 嵌套查询
      • 6.5.1 普通嵌套查询
      • 6.5.2 使用量词的嵌套查询
      • 6.5.3 内层、外层互相关嵌套查询
      • 6.5.4 使用EXISTS的嵌套查询
      • 6.5.5 使用WITH的嵌套查询
    • 6.6 SELECT查询的集合操作
      • 6.6.1 UNION集合运算
      • 6.6.2 INTERSECT集合运算
      • 6.6.3 EXCEPT集合运算
    • 6.7 需要查询支持的数据操作
      • 6.7.1 插入操作
      • 6.7.2 更新操作
      • 6.7.3 删除操作
    • 6.8 视图
      • 6.8.1 视图概述
      • 6.8.2 创建视图
      • 6.8.3 使用视图
      • 6.8.4 修改和删除视图
    • 本章小结
    • 习题与练习
  • 第7章 openGauss数据库编程
    • 7.1 PL/SQL简介
      • 7.1.1 PL/SQL块的结构和分类
      • 7.1.2 定义变量
      • 7.1.3 变量赋值
      • 7.1.4 数组
      • 7.1.5 控制语句
    • 7.2 存储过程
      • 7.2.1 存储过程概述
      • 7.2.2 创建和调用存储过程
      • 7.2.3 修改和删除存储过程
    • 7.3 用户自定义函数
      • 7.3.1 PL/pgSQL语言函数概述
      • 7.3.2 创建和调用用户自定义函数
      • 7.3.3 修改和删除自定义函数
    • 7.4 游标
      • 7.4.1 显式游标
      • 7.4.2 显式游标的应用举例
      • 7.4.3 隐式游标
      • 7.4.4 游标FOR循环
    • 7.5 触发器
      • 7.5.1 触发器概述
      • 7.5.2 创建触发器
      • 7.5.3 触发器函数中的特殊变量
      • 7.5.4 触发器应用举例
      • 7.5.5 管理触发器
    • 本章小结
    • 习题与练习
  • 第8章 openGauss数据库安全管理
    • 8.1 安全管理概述
      • 8.1.1 openGauss的安全机制体系
      • 8.1.2 openGauss安全认证
    • 8.2 用户管理
      • 8.2.1 数据库用户的分类
      • 8.2.2 三权分立
      • 8.2.3 创建用户
      • 8.2.4 管理用户
    • 8.3 角色管理
      • 8.3.1 创建角色
      • 8.3.2 管理角色
    • 8.4 权限管理
      • 8.4.1 权限概述
      • 8.4.2 授权
      • 8.4.3 收回权限
      • 8.4.4 行级访问控制
    • 8.5 设置安全策略
      • 8.5.1 设置账户安全策略
      • 8.5.2 设置账号有效期
      • 8.5.3 设置密码安全策略
    • 本章小结
    • 习题与练习
  • 第9章 openGauss数据库的事务管理与备份恢复
    • 9.1 数据库的事务
      • 9.1.1 事务的概念
      • 9.1.2 事务的性质
      • 9.1.3 SQL对事务的支持
      • 9.1.4 简单事务管理
      • 9.1.5 事务保存点
    • 9.2 事务隔离与并发控制
      • 9.2.1 事务的隔离
      • 9.2.2 并发控制
    • 9.3 openGauss数据库备份与恢复
      • 9.3.1 概述
      • 9.3.2 逻辑备份与恢复
      • 9.3.3 物理备份与恢复
    • 本章小结
    • 习题与练习
  • 附录1 考试指导
  • 附录2 使用虚拟机镜像文件安装部署openGauss
  • 附录3 全国计算机等级考试二级openGauss数据库程序设计考试大纲(2022年版)
  • 附录4 全国计算机等级考试二级openGauss数据库程序设计样题及参考答案
  • 附录5 各章习题与练习答案
  • 参考书目

相关图书